Infinnium LLC, Virginia based software company that develops solutions to improve information management and business decision-making through effective use of the latest artificial intelligence technology, announced today a multimillion-dollar seed investment in the company.

The investment was made by the Sahajanand Group, a technology conglomerate which has historically built successful enterprises based on emerging technologies. The Sahajanand Group of Companies, headquartered in India, is focused on developing pioneering smart technologies to bring groundbreaking solutions to the world’s most pressing challenges. The investment in Infinnium recognizes the potential for AI and other data technologies to address growing challenges in data privacy, data protection and regulatory compliance.

Company leaders at Infinnium plan to use the funding to support the final development efforts and market introduction of its 4iG™ Suite of solutions. The 4iG product suite leverages AI technology to provide visibility across an organization’s data repositories, offering insights into both structured and unstructured data. The 4iG framework allows corporations, law firms and other organizations to identify, analyze and govern information assets in support of business decision-making, data security and regulatory compliance.

ObscurePI™, a key module of the 4iG Suite, focuses on identification and management of personally identifiable information – a key component of HIPAA, GDPR, CCPA, Sarbanes-Oxley, FISMA and other data privacy and compliance regulations.
